Charging for Parking

While I don't care to pay for parking. I certainly wouldn't change my hotel because of a $6.00 parking fee. (or $10, or $15)

Someone suggested that they just add the fee into the room. Well, what is the difference? You would pay the same amount.

The parking fee means that those who fly in, and take a shuttle to their hotel, do not have to pay for an amenity that they are not using. Why should all rates go up, so that people can think they are not paying for parking?

As for the Disney resorts, they may not charge you a separate parking fee, but they certainly are getting the money from you in higher resort rates. (much higher rates than Universal)

On our last trip, we saved over $500 at HRH using discounts that were offered. I can dismiss the parking fees when I know I am getting such a great rate to begin with.
